Solve the quadratic equation for x. What is one of the roots?

(x + 6)2 = 49

A) −13
B) −6
C) −7
D) −1

Answer:

A) −13

Step-by-step explanation:

(x + 6)^2 = 49

Take the square root of each side

sqrt((x + 6)^2) = ±sqrt(49)

x+6 = ±7

Subtract 6 from each side

x+6-6 = -6  ±7

x =-6  ±7

Separating into 2 parts

x = -6+7          x = -6-7

x = 1               x = -13
